On Wed, Oct 16, 2019 at 03:30:03PM -0700, Tony Lindgren wrote:
> Hi,
> 
> Here are few fixes for cpcap charger and battery. These can probably wait
> for v5.5 if preferred that way and can be applied separate from the 4.2V
> charger fix.
> 
> Regards,
> 
> Tony
> 
> Changes since v2:
> 
> - Drop the pointless test for latest->voltage >= 0 as noted by Pavel
> 
> - Allow poweroff to trigger at 3.2V and lower as suggested by Pavel
> 
> Changes since v1:
> 
> - Sent the updated 4.2V voltage fix separately
> 
> Tony Lindgren (2):
>   power: supply: cpcap-battery: Check voltage before orderly_poweroff
>   power: supply: cpcap-charger: Improve battery detection
> 
>  drivers/power/supply/cpcap-battery.c | 8 +++++---
>  drivers/power/supply/cpcap-charger.c | 7 ++++---
>  2 files changed, 9 insertions(+), 6 deletions(-)
